How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Klein?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Klein 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,280 | $769 | $2,259 |
| Klein 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,671 | $1,025 | $3,205 |
| Klein 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,255 | $1,646 | $3,336 |
| Klein 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,995 | $2,945 | $3,045 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Klein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Klein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Klein is $1,280.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Klein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Klein is a 1,034 square feet unit starting from $1,877 at Ivy Point Klein.
What is the average size for Klein 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Klein is currently 765 sq ft.
